PARTIAL ELECTROCHEMICAL OXIDATION OF METHANE UNDER MILD CONDITIONS

We have made a preliminary study of the partial oxidation of methane at 25-degrees-C in aqueous media. The reactions were performed by using gold, glassy carbon, Cu and Hg cathodes in an alkaline electrolyte containing dissolved O2. The main oxidation products under these new reaction conditions are formaldehyde and methanol. The rates of formaldehyde formation increased with cathodic current density. The CH2O formation rate at a Cu electrode at 50 mA cm-2 was 1.5 x 10(-3) mol cm-2 h-1 during the first 18 min of the reaction. The CH2O concentration oscillated with time, and CO and CO2 were usually minor reaction products. The oxygen species, long-lived O2-, is suggested to play a role in CH4 activation.
